492 Elderly Residents in Cipayung Vaccinated with COVID-19

As many as 492 elderly residents in Cipayung Sub-district, East Jakarta have received COVID-19 vaccine at the SDN Munjul 01 building, Tuesday (3/9). According to the plan, it will last until Wednesday (3/10).

From the target of 600 elderly today, only 492 people participated or about 80 percent

Munjul Urban Village Head Sumarjono said, initially 600 seniors were invited to take the vaccine today. However, when being screened, some could not be vaccinated, because of comorbidities (comorbid). While some others were absent and would be rescheduled.

"From the target of 600 elderly today, only 492 people participated or about 80 percent," he said.

To smoothen it, he prepared as many as 60 medical workers.

"While waiting for their turn to vaccinate, we give them (elderly) drinks and snacks thus they don't get bored of waiting," he furthered.

As for the information, it is not only participated by Munjul people, but also residents from seven other urban villages, namely Cipayung, Pondok Ranggon, Cilangkap, Ceger, Setu, Bambu Apus, and Lubang Buaya.
